The College of Biosciences (COLBIOS), Federal University of Agriculture, Abeokuta (FUNAAB), has posthumously honoured the late Prof. Oladipo Ademuyiwa, a distinguished Biochemical Toxicologist, with the formal presentation of his 99th Inaugural Lecture booklet, titled “Toxicants and Man: The Enigma of Frenemy.”

The event, held today, March 12, 2025, at the COLBIOS Foyer, was a solemn tribute to the revered scholar, who was originally scheduled to deliver the lecture on this day before his passing on February 16, 2025. He was laid to rest on February 28, 2025.

Fulfilling a promise made by the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Babatunde Kehinde, the University ensured the publication of the Inaugural Lecture booklet as a mark of respect and recognition of Prof. Ademuyiwa’s immense scholarly contributions. The presentation not only honoured his legacy but also reinforced FUNAAB’s commitment to preserving the intellectual works of its esteemed academics.
